How Do Title Pawn Services in Arlington Actually Work? A title pawn, also called a car title loan, involves a straightforward exchange. The lender evaluates your vehicle's current market value, offers a loan amount based on a percentage of that value, and holds onto your car title as security. You keep physical possession of the car the entire time. The loan term typically runs 30 days, after which you repay the principal plus any finance charges to reclaim your title.
Essential Documents to Bring to Your Arlington Title Loan Consultation Lenders in Arlington typically ask for the same core set of items. You will need a government-issued photo ID (driver's license or passport), proof of residency (utility bill or lease), and proof of income (recent pay stubs or bank statements). The most important document is your vehicle's clear title - the official document showing you are the sole owner without any liens. If the title is lost, contact the Texas Department of Motor Vehicles to request a duplicate before your appointment.
Once you submit these documents, the lender reviews them and appraises your car on the spot. Many Arlington title pawn services provide approval in 30 to 60 minutes, and you can often walk out with cash the same day. No credit check is involved, which is the primary reason people with low credit scores turn to this option.
The amount you qualify for depends on several factors. Lenders in Arlington use standard valuation guides such as Kelley Blue Book to determine your vehicle's wholesale value. Most then lend between 25% and 50% of that figure. A well-maintained sedan valued at $8,000, for example, might secure a loan of $2,500 to $4,000. The condition, mileage, and model year all play a role in the final offer. What Determines the Cost of a Title Loan in Arlington? The cost of a car title loan goes far beyond the advertised monthly rate. Lenders calculate the amount you can borrow based on a percentage of your car's wholesale or trade-in value, known as the loan-to-value (LTV) ratio. The interest is typically structured as a monthly fee applied to the borrowed amount, and this is where costs can add up quickly if you are not careful.
How Much Can You Borrow Against Your Vehicle? The amount you can borrow depends on the wholesale market value of your car. Lenders use standard appraisal guides to estimate what your vehicle would sell for in a quick sale. For example, if your car is appraised at $8,000, you might be able to borrow between $2,000 and $4,000. Factors that influence the appraised value include the vehicle's age, overall condition, mileage, and any existing damage. Newer cars in good condition naturally command higher loan amounts, while older vehicles with high mileage or visible wear will have a lower ceiling. Calculate the total cost of the longest term you might need. Suppose you borrow $1,000 at 20 percent monthly interest for 30 days. The cost is $200. If you renew once for another 30 days, the total cost becomes $400. Comparing this scenario across lenders reveals which one offers the most affordable path if your repayment is delayed.
